Police say a 2-year-old Utah boy passed away Friday after his 3-year-old sister accidentally shot him in the stomach with a rifle.

Authorities in Cache County said that the girl fired a .22 caliber weapon in the deadly incident, KSL reports.

“The gun had been used earlier in the day by the victim’s father and was set down after returning home,” said Cache County Sheriff’s Lt. Mike Peterson, according to KUTV. “The gun was in an unloaded state but did have live rounds in the magazine. We believe the three-year-old had to manipulate the action enough to chamber a live round prior to the incident occurring.”

The children’s parents were at home when the gun discharged, and the boy’s mother immediately called for help. The boy was rushed in critical condition to Logan Regional hospital for surgery, before being flown to Primary Children’s Hospital, where he later died, according to the Salt Lake Tribune.

While authorities believe that the shooting was accidental, a report will be sent to the county Attorney’s Office for review. The county attorney will decide if charges will be filed.

The victim’s name was not immediately released.
